Military Battery Market size was valued at USD 1.7 Billion in 2024 and is poised to grow from USD 1.97 Billion in 2025 to USD 6.5 Billion by 2033, growing at a CAGR of 16.1% during the forecast period (2026-2033).
The military battery market is experiencing significant growth driven by advancements in battery technology, specifically in battery chemistry and design. The shift towards lithium-ion, solid-state, and other next-gen batteries delivers enhanced energy density, longevity, and safety, improving the effectiveness of military applications such as drones and electric machines. Increased defense budgets globally further stimulate demand for advanced military batteries, as nations invest heavily in upgrading their military capabilities. This includes acquiring complex electronic warfare systems and unmanned systems that require reliable power sources. Innovations in battery performance, such as improved longevity and energy efficiency, are critical to the operational success of military platforms, from handheld devices to sophisticated weaponry, underscoring the demand for specialized battery technologies to support diverse military requirements.

Military Battery Market Segments Analysis
Global Military Battery Market is segmented by Platform, Composition, Type, Installation, Application, Voltage, Power Density, and region. Based on Platform, the market is segmented into Ground (Armored Vehicles, Operating Bases, Soldiers), Airborne (Fighter Aircraft, Special Mission Aircraft, Transport Aircraft, Military Helicopters), and Marine (Destroyers, Frigates, Amphibious Ships, Submarines, Offshore Patrol Vessels, Corvettes). Based on Type, the market is segmented into Non-rechargeable (Reserve, Primary), Rechargeable. Based on Application, the market is segmented into Propulsion, and Non-propulsion. Based on Composition, the market is segmented into Rotary Lithium-based (Lithium Nickel Manganese Cobalt Oxide (LI-NMC), Lithium Iron Phosphate (LFP), Lithium Cobalt Oxide (LCO), Lithium Titanate Oxide (LTO), Lithium Manganese Oxide (LMO), Lithium Nickel Cobalt Aluminum Oxide (NCA)), Lead-acid, Nickel-based, Thermal, and Others. Based on Installation the market is segmented into OEM, Aftermarket. Based on Voltage, the market is segmented into Less than 12V, 12-24V, and more than 24V. Based on Power density, the market is segmented into Less than 100 Wh/Kg, 100-200 Wh/Kg, and More than 200 Wh/Kg. Based on region, the market is segmented into North America, Europe, Asia Pacific, Latin America and Middle East & and Africa.
Driver of the Military Battery Market
One of the key market drivers for the Global Military Battery Market is the increasing demand for portable and efficient energy storage solutions to enhance the operational capabilities of defense forces. As military operations become more reliant on advanced technology, such as drones, communication devices, and electronic warfare systems, the need for lightweight, durable, and high-performance batteries rises. This demand is further fueled by the trend toward electrification in military vehicles and equipment, which necessitates batteries that can withstand harsh environments while providing reliable power. Consequently, innovations in battery chemistry and management systems are vital to meet these growing requirements.
Restraints in the Military Battery Market
One significant market restraint for the global military battery market is the high cost associated with the development and procurement of advanced battery technologies. Military applications demand batteries that not only meet stringent performance requirements but also ensure reliability under extreme conditions, which drives up research, development, and manufacturing expenses. Additionally, the lengthy certification processes required for military-grade batteries further contribute to increased costs and lead times. This financial burden can limit budget allocations for defense organizations, discouraging investments in newer technologies and potentially slowing overall market growth.
Market Trends of the Military Battery Market
The military battery market is currently witnessing a significant trend driven by the increasing deployment of military drones, which are rapidly becoming essential assets for surveillance and reconnaissance operations. The enhanced capabilities of unmanned aerial vehicles (UAVs) in combat scenarios are accelerating the demand for high-performance battery systems that can ensure extended operational duration and reliability. As defense organizations prioritize the advancement of battery technologies tailored for both military and commercial UAVs, innovations in energy density, weight reduction, and recharge efficiency are gaining prominence. This evolution reflects a broader commitment to integrating cutting-edge technology in defense strategies, enhancing overall mission effectiveness.
